Abstract :
LINEAR servomechanisms have found widespread application primarily because of their inherent simplicity. This simplicity is reflected both in the physical structure of an approximately linear system and in its analysis. It is well known that the performance of a nonlinear servomechanism may be considerably better than that of a comparable linear one. Second-order systems may be investigated semianalytically by the phase plane approach. Unfortunately however, analytical methods for the design of more general nonlinear servo systems are virtually nonexistent. An analytical method based on a rather restrictive approximation was proposed by Kochenburger1 for analyzing contactor servos. Extension of Kochenburger´s method to more general problems is discussed by Johnson.2
